claimLegal financial obligations (LFOs) are associated with longer periods of homelessness.
claimCourt-imposed fines are a feature of the homelessness-incarceration nexus, with legal debt correlating to the duration of homelessness in Seattle, Washington, according to a 2020 study by J. Mogk, V. Shmigol, M. Futrell, B. Stover, and A. Hagopian.
claimMedical debt is the leading cause of personal bankruptcy and is associated with an increased risk of becoming homeless.
